Luxurious Rooms with Modern Comforts
At Stone Mill Inn, the Saint Catharines hotel, guests can indulge in one of the 34 meticulously appointed guestrooms. Each room features modern conveniences such as refrigerators and microwaves, ensuring your stay is as comfortable as possible. For those seeking additional space to relax, some rooms boast a seating area and an intimate living room area with a queen pull-out couch, perfect for unwinding after a busy day.
Culinary Delights at Johnny Rocco's Grill at The Stone Mill Inn
Dining at this Saint Catharines inn is an experience not to be missed. The on-site restaurant, Johnny Rocco's Grill, specializes in Italian cuisine and serves lunch and dinner, offering guests a taste of Italy without leaving the hotel. Whether you're looking for a hearty meal or a light snack, the restaurant's diverse menu is sure to satisfy any appetite.

Entertainment and Leisure Activities at Stone Mill Inn
Guests looking for entertainment won't have to venture far. The hotel's proximity to local attractions such as the FirstOntario Performing Arts Centre, just 2.8 miles away, and Brock University, located 2.6 miles from the hotel, provides ample opportunities for cultural exploration and leisure activities. Additionally, some of the area's activities can be experienced at Port Dalhousie Pier Marina, guaranteeing fun for travelers of all interests.
